About LRMDA
This gene encodes a leucine-rich repeat protein. The encoded protein is thought to play a role in melanocyte differentiation. Mutations in this gene have been associated with autosomal recessive oculocutaneous albinism 7 (OCA7). Alternatively spliced transcript variants have been identified. [provided by RefSeq, Mar 2015]
